April 2021 BoxyCharm base box choice is now open!

The choice items for April are:

  • EARTH HARBOR AURORA Superfood Luminance Ampoule
  • STUDIOMAKEUP Tinted Moisturizer
  • TOUCH IN SOL Pretty Filter Icy Sherbet Primer 50g

What do you think of the spoilers?

If you haven’t signed up for this box yet, the regular BoxyCharm box is $25 a month.
